To be eligible, applicants must have been offering programs to the public since March 2019. The department said Veronica O’Hern, the Iowa Arts Council’s grant services and artist program manager, will answer application questions via email at veronica.ohern@iowa.gov.
At Hoyt Sherman Place, the historic, 1,252-seat theater in Des Moines Sherman Hill neighborhood, Executive Director Robert Warren was wasting no time seeking a share of the assistance, which can range from $1,500 to $250,000, depending on the amount lost to coronavirus-related disruptions.
